使用Oracle代码实现迈向数据库的全面操控(oracle代码实现)
使用Oracle代码实现迈向数据库的全面操控
数据库是现代企业不可或缺的一环,而 Oracle 数据库是其中最为知名和广泛应用的一种。在企业中,对数据库进行全面操控是非常重要的,因为只有对数据库进行全面的管理,才能够更好地维护和管理数据,保证企业数据的安全和稳定。在这种情况下,使用 Oracle 代码就成为了必不可少的一种技能。下面,我们将介绍如何使用 Oracle 代码实现数据库的全面操控。
1. Oracle 数据库基础
想要使用 Oracle 代码进行数据库操控,首先需要了解一些基础的 Oracle 数据库知识。Oracle 数据库最基本的组成部分是实例和数据库,其中实例是指 Oracle 数据库系统在内存中的一个运行环境,而数据库则是指物理存储设备上的数据存储区域。如果我们想要使用 Oracle 代码进行数据库操控,就必须先启动实例。启动实例的命令如下:
$ sqlplus / as sysdba
SQL> startup
这样,我们就可以启动 Oracle 实例来操作数据库了。
2. 数据库连接
Oracle 数据库支持多种连接方式,常用的有使用 sqlplus 进行连接和使用 JDBC 进行连接等。使用 sqlplus 进行连接时,先启动 sqlplus 程序,然后在控制台中输入用户名和密码进行连接。例如:
$ sqlplus sys/oracle@orcl as sysdba
这样,我们就可以连接到名为 orcl 的 Oracle 数据库上,并以 sys 用户权限进行操控。
3. 查看数据库信息
Oracle 数据库有许多重要的系统表,可以用来查看数据库的各种信息。例如,我们可以使用下面的命令来查看数据库的版本信息:
SQL> select * from v$version;
这个命令会返回数据库的版本号、服务器名、创建时间等信息。
4. 创建表和插入数据
Oracle 操作表和数据的方式非常灵活,我们可以使用 SQL 语句进行操作。例如,下面的代码可以用来创建一个名为 employees 的表:
CREATE TABLE employees (
id NUMBER(4) PRIMARY KEY,
name VARCHAR2(100),
age NUMBER(2),
eml VARCHAR2(100)
);
接下来,我们可以使用 INSERT 语句向表中插入数据,例如:
INSERT INTO employees (id, name, age, eml)
VALUES (1, ‘张三’, 25, ‘zhangsan@abc.com’);
这样就可以向 employees 表中插入一条数据。同样,我们也可以使用 UPDATE 和 DELETE 语句来更新和删除数据。
5. 用户管理
在 Oracle 数据库中,用户管理也是非常重要的一环。我们可以使用 SQL 语句进行增删改查等操作。例如,下面的代码可以用来创建一个名为 testuser 的用户:
CREATE USER testuser IDENTIFIED BY testpass;
接下来,我们可以使用 GRANT 来给 testuser 用户授予权限。例如,我们可以使用下面的命令来给 testuser 用户授予 employees 表的 SELECT 权限:
GRANT SELECT ON employees TO testuser;
这样,testuser 用户就可以查询 employees 表了。
使用 Oracle 代码进行数据库操控是非常重要的技能,可以帮助企业更好地管理和维护数据库。通过本文的介绍,相信大家已经了解了 Oracle 数据库的基础知识以及如何使用 Oracle 代码进行数据库操控。希望大家能够在实践中不断掌握这一技能,为企业的数据库管理工作贡献自己的力量。